Preparing the Manufacturing Workforce for Industry 4.0. Industry 4.0, also known as the fourth industrial revolution, is the trend of increasing automation and data exchange in manufacturing technologies, including developments in artificial intelligence, the Internet of Things, and advanced robotics. What are Smart Manufacturing, Smart Factory, and Smart Industry? Smart manufacturing, smart factory, and smart industry are all related concepts that refer to the use of advanced technologies and data analytics to improve manufacturing processes and increase efficiency.
